**Ticket: Config drift on TilePress cache layer**

The tile-rendering cache on the Orvane cluster has drifted from the baseline again. TTLs on the midwest nodes differ from what the deploy manifest specifies, which explains the stale map tiles customers reported this week. Please don't hand-edit nodes; changes get wiped on redeploy anyway. For reference when triaging tickets, the intended baseline configuration is listed below.

service settings:
OLIAX_PIN=2115
OLIAX_METRICS_HOST=metrics.oliax.paliqsys.corp
OLIAX_LOG_LEVEL=error
OLIAX_TENANT=ulador

Ticket: Unlock migration vault for Ironvine ORM refactor

New team members: the legacy Ironvine ORM layer is being replaced module by module, and the schema snapshots needed for safe refactoring sit in a locked vault nobody has opened since the last owner left. We recovered the credentials from escrow this week. The passphrase follows below.

unlock words, kajog-yawip: istwyn-casath-aldok

Handover Note — From Director S. Quillan to Director M. Orbeck

Branch managers: this covers the launch plan for the Pellwright Duo range. Manufacturing is on schedule at the Avenford site; first stock ships in week 14. Training packs go out to branches two weeks ahead of launch. Marja takes over launch coordination from Monday, including the demo-unit allocation. Pricing is final and must not be pre-announced. The positioning rationale we agreed is set out in the note below.

confidential, kagup-bafog: Fraaxax Group is in early talks to buy Soroxox Group for about $343.8 million. The Olidor launch date is June 14, and nothing goes to the press before then. Legal wants the Aldmirek Logistics term sheet signed before July 23.

There are three environments: dev, staging, and prod. Dev allows destructive schema edits and is wiped nightly. Staging mirrors prod compatibility rules (backward-transitive) but uses a separate storage bucket and shorter cache TTLs. Prod is write-restricted; new subjects require a merged proposal and a compatibility check in CI. All environments share the same container image, differing only by injected settings. For review purposes, the staging environment runs with the configuration below.

config for kajef-hahof:
[ulamir]
port = 5672
region = central-1
host = ulamir.lumicsys.corp
timeout_ms = 2000
retries = 3